HUMAN PERFORMANCE
Aaron Katz (P50) is the Article 114 Rep for Human Performance. His report is below:
NAS Training Study - The report was briefed to leadership at the November SLM
meeting.
Safety Culture - The out brief was scheduled for the week of Jan. 6. The facility has not
confirmed dates and P80 is in the process of an ATM changeover. They may request to
hold off until the new ATM has time to settle in.
CHI Team Training - The CHI team asked us if we could provide them some basic HF
training. The training was ready to be delivered for the last week of October, but the CHI
team could not coordinate their travel. The class has been tentatively scheduled now for
the week of Jan. 28 in Washington.
Training Effectiveness Survey - All dates have been coordinated. Data collection will be
completed by February 2020.
Behavioral Markers - All interviews have been completed. I will work with NASA to
ensure the recordings are deleted. Once the data is processed, the hope is that we can
develop training to bring to the field.
Visual Scanning - All site visits are now complete and CAMI will begin to process the
research. The next step should be taking their findings and see if we can develop some
effective training from the results.
HP Taxonomy - All work has been completed and a meeting occurred the week of Dec.
16 with joint sponsors Steve Hansen and Tony Schneider.
New HP Areas - I briefed the NEB during the week of Nov. 4. I covered a number of
topics that I would like the HP office to pursue. I wanted to open a dialogue so that
anyone from the board who wants our office to pursue an idea can have a vehicle to do
so. Ideas included: mental health awareness, inter-facility relationships, speech rate and
tone training, and a few others.
Large Monitor Issues - I have been brought into the identified issues with the
implementation of new 43" monitors. Test sites are ZFW, ZOB, and ZMP. I have worked
with Tom Adcock and Rex Jackson and am tentatively slated to field visit ZFW and ZMP
the week of Jan. 6.
